Comprehending Refractive Lens Exchange



Recognizing Refractive Lens Exchange (RLE) can be vital for those taking into consideration vision improvement options.

RLE is a surgical procedure that changes your eye's natural lens with a synthetic intraocular lens. It's largely targeted at remedying serious refractive mistakes, such as hyperopia, myopia, or presbyopia.

During the treatment, your doctor will eliminate your cloudy or clear lens and replace it with a lens customized to your vision requires. This choice is usually considered for people over 40 who may not appropriate prospects for LASIK.

By choosing RLE, you're not just boosting your vision; you're additionally potentially reducing your dependence on glasses or call lenses.

Understanding exactly how RLE jobs will equip you to make informed choices concerning your vision wellness.

Eligibility Standard for Refractive Lens Exchange



Prior to taking into consideration Refractive Lens Exchange (RLE), it's crucial to identify if you satisfy the qualification requirements. Generally, you're an excellent candidate if you more than 40 years old and have a stable prescription.

You must additionally be experiencing refractive errors like myopia, hyperopia, or presbyopia. It is necessary to have healthy eyes with no substantial diseases, such as cataracts or glaucoma.

Furthermore, you must remain in great total health and not have any conditions that could influence healing, like unrestrained diabetes mellitus. If you wear contact lenses, you may need to quit using them for some time before your analysis.



Consulting with an eye care professional will assist you comprehend your details scenario and whether RLE is right for you.
